## Step 4: Configure the gateway box

Okay, almost there. Once the HarrowLink telemetry gateway binary is on the host, drop a .env next to it. Set GATEWAY_REGION=west-plains and INGEST_INTERVAL=30 so the combines don't flood us with readings. Double-check UPLINK_RETRIES=5, because the default of zero bit us last sprint when the silo site lost signal. Last bit: the gateway needs its broker credential to publish anything, so add that line here.

vault entry, yajop-bafop: ARCHIVE_KEY3=8d4

**Q: Who can actually edit release pages in the Fernwiki?**

Good question — it trips everyone up. Editors in the "release-crew" role can change pages under /releases, but only Stewards can publish them. If you're release-managing for Project Tansy, ask Odile to bump your role; it takes effect on next login. One quirk: role changes don't invalidate open sessions, so log out first. To unlock the admin role panel in a pinch, use the recovery passphrase below.

unlock words, hahip-baduf: holwyn-istath-julvan

## Runbook: Stale-Cache Incident (Murkwell Catalog)

Quick recap for the release freeze decision: last Tuesday the Murkwell catalog served day-old prices because the cache invalidation hook silently failed after the Ashgrove deploy. The fix is in, but we added a TTL backstop so stale entries can't live longer than an hour even if invalidation breaks again. Please confirm these values made it into the release branch before you sign off. Here's the backstop configuration.

settings of fafog-haduf:
ZORIX_PIN=4648
ZORIX_METRICS_HOST=metrics.zorix.paliqsys.corp
ZORIX_LOG_LEVEL=info
ZORIX_TENANT=druix